    Pre-Filtration Strategies for Enhanced Cleanroom Protection

    Effective sterile area safeguard copyrights heavily on implementing tiered upstream filtration systems. These first-stage removal processes act to minimize the load on downstream high-efficiency filters , improving their operational time and maintaining reliable air . Frequent preliminary filtration options feature basic particulate screens , MERV graded air purifiers, and charged initial filters , each offering a unique amount of contaminant elimination.

    Beyond HEPA: Emerging Filtration Technologies for Cleanrooms

    While Advanced Dust Filters (HEPA) remain the industry standard for cleanroom air purification, evolving scientific advances are driving the development of promising next-generation filtration technologies. These include ultraviolet UV systems that inactivate biological contaminants, electrostatic ionizers which reduce particle load before it reaches HEPA filters, and membrane systems utilizing nanomaterials structures for even finer particle separation. Researchers are also investigating active methods incorporating sensors to dynamically adjust filtration performance based on real-time airborne contaminant levels, potentially enhancing both cleanroom performance and operational efficiency.

    Layered Filtration: Maximizing Cleanroom Air Quality Efficiency

    Achieving superior cleanroom air purity demands a sophisticated - layered purification system . Standard single-stage filters often prove insufficient to capture minute debris. A layered screening method , incorporating pre-filters , medium rating filters, and high- performance particulate air filters, substantially diminishes the total impurity burden , improving sterile operation and lessening the possibility of product contamination . This holistic approach ensures a consistent and sterile setting.
